Description
ornamented wooden shaft turning into a funnel-shaped base, crowned by two split clamps, where the obsidian tips are inserted and fixed by cord and parinarium nut paste, typical rhomb patterns accentuated by red and white pigment, slightly dam., one obsidian tip broken, crack, metal socle
